quote:

Just take the Magazine Street bus.


This is my advice, too. The Magazine route is one of the few in the city that is actually reliable and runs with somewhat frequency. Just get a day pass for like $3.00 and hop on and off as needed.

quote:

I'd get dropped off at Mag and Felicity and walk up river towards the park.


This. Theres some stuff she should check out from there to Jackson. And there's places for you to stop and drink. Then I'd grab a bus or another cab and stop around Washington and walk up to Louisiana. Ample drinking while she shops that stretch too. There's some stuff between Louisiana and Napoleon, but it's a lot of shops that have like 3 things but are probably all drug fronts because how else could they stay open. Then I'd stop again around Jefferson if you have any money left.

This does not account for food stops. I'd probably eat lunch at LPG or Shaya, which forces a stop around Napoleon.
